CANADIAN STAGE

It’s been quite a season thus far-lots of traveling, performing, teaching and developing new work. In the past six months I’ve gone to Miami twice, Pennsylvania three times, New York City (performance @ Lincoln Center), Dallas, a 5 week stint in Los Angeles, England and Turkmenistan. WILL POWER GRABS COVETED 2010 MEADOWS PRIZE!

So excited about this one.  Click here for details, and we’ll see you down south!

The Meadows School of the Arts at Southern Methodist University has selected two recipients for the second annual 2010 Meadows Prize arts residency: playwright and performer Will Power and choreographer Shen Wei.
